American Golf and the City of Long Beach Department
of Parks, Recreation & Marine are pleased to invite
you to the 22nd Annual Long Beach Open Golf Tournament to
be competed on July 29-August 1, 2010, at El Dorado Park
and Skylinks Golf Courses.
American Golf has guaranteed the purse at
$160,000. Their generous contributions over the years demonstrate
their desire to make this the best event in the Western
United States. In addition to the guaranteed purse, the
tournament features a practice round at each course, food
& beverages for the players, complimentary range balls
during the tournament and other amenities.
We look forward to having you participate
in the $160,000 Long Beach Open.

THE TOURNAMENT
- The Long Beach Open will be 72 holes of stroke play, held
July 29-August 1, 2010
- The field will be cut to low 60 professionals and ties
after 36 holes.
- The Long Beach Open is open to all professional golfers.
- Caddies are allowed.
- Carts will be allowed for players only (at player’s
expense). No spectator carts will be permitted.
- Maximum of 2 carts per group.
ENTRY FEE
- Entry fee for professionals is $700.
- Entry fee will include:
- One practice round at each course
- Food and beverage during tournament days
- Complimentary range balls during tournament days
DEADLINES
- Deadline for entries is July 15, 2010 or when
the field is full. The field has filled before
the deadline date for the last 6 years.
- Late entries will be accepted, but will be subject to
a $25 additional fee. No personal checks will be accepted
as payment for late entries. Pairings will be posted at
El Dorado beginning July 27, 2010.
- All returned checks will be charged a $25 handling charge.
- If you withdraw before July 16, 2010, you will receive
a refund, minus a $25 service charge. Withdrawal on or after
July 16, 2010, will be subject to a $50 service charge if
you are replaced. If you are not replaced, you will not
be refunded. If you do not show up for your tee time, are
disqualified, or withdraw within 24 hours of the first day
of the tournament, you will not receive a refund.

MISCELLANEOUS
- No metal spikes will be allowed.
- Players may not wear shorts during the tournament. Players
and caddies must wear collared shirts.
- Unprofessional behavior will not be tolerated. Vulgar
language or club throwing may result in disqualification.
- All players must pick up their player information package
at El Dorado Park Golf Course on Tuesday or Skylinks Golf
Course on Wednesday (July 28 or July 29) during the practice
rounds.
- Players must check in at the registration table each day
of the tournament.
- Misrepresentation of ability level could result in disqualification,
at the discretion of the Tournament Committee, with no refund.
